Copyright | (c) Sven Panne 2019 |
---|---|
License | BSD3 |
Maintainer | Sven Panne <svenpanne@gmail.com> |
Stability | stable |
Portability | portable |
Safe Haskell | None |
Language | Haskell2010 |
Synopsis
- glGetARBVertexBlend :: MonadIO m => m Bool
- gl_ARB_vertex_blend :: Bool
- pattern GL_ACTIVE_VERTEX_UNITS_ARB :: GLenum
- pattern GL_CURRENT_WEIGHT_ARB :: GLenum
- pattern GL_MAX_VERTEX_UNITS_ARB :: GLenum
- pattern GL_MODELVIEW0_ARB :: GLenum
- pattern GL_MODELVIEW10_ARB :: GLenum
- pattern GL_MODELVIEW11_ARB :: GLenum
- pattern GL_MODELVIEW12_ARB :: GLenum
- pattern GL_MODELVIEW13_ARB :: GLenum
- pattern GL_MODELVIEW14_ARB :: GLenum
- pattern GL_MODELVIEW15_ARB :: GLenum
- pattern GL_MODELVIEW16_ARB :: GLenum
- pattern GL_MODELVIEW17_ARB :: GLenum
- pattern GL_MODELVIEW18_ARB :: GLenum
- pattern GL_MODELVIEW19_ARB :: GLenum
- pattern GL_MODELVIEW1_ARB :: GLenum
- pattern GL_MODELVIEW20_ARB :: GLenum
- pattern GL_MODELVIEW21_ARB :: GLenum
- pattern GL_MODELVIEW22_ARB :: GLenum
- pattern GL_MODELVIEW23_ARB :: GLenum
- pattern GL_MODELVIEW24_ARB :: GLenum
- pattern GL_MODELVIEW25_ARB :: GLenum
- pattern GL_MODELVIEW26_ARB :: GLenum
- pattern GL_MODELVIEW27_ARB :: GLenum
- pattern GL_MODELVIEW28_ARB :: GLenum
- pattern GL_MODELVIEW29_ARB :: GLenum
- pattern GL_MODELVIEW2_ARB :: GLenum
- pattern GL_MODELVIEW30_ARB :: GLenum
- pattern GL_MODELVIEW31_ARB :: GLenum
- pattern GL_MODELVIEW3_ARB :: GLenum
- pattern GL_MODELVIEW4_ARB :: GLenum
- pattern GL_MODELVIEW5_ARB :: GLenum
- pattern GL_MODELVIEW6_ARB :: GLenum
- pattern GL_MODELVIEW7_ARB :: GLenum
- pattern GL_MODELVIEW8_ARB :: GLenum
- pattern GL_MODELVIEW9_ARB :: GLenum
- pattern GL_VERTEX_BLEND_ARB :: GLenum
- pattern GL_WEIGHT_ARRAY_ARB :: GLenum
- pattern GL_WEIGHT_ARRAY_POINTER_ARB :: GLenum
- pattern GL_WEIGHT_ARRAY_SIZE_ARB :: GLenum
- pattern GL_WEIGHT_ARRAY_STRIDE_ARB :: GLenum
- pattern GL_WEIGHT_ARRAY_TYPE_ARB :: GLenum
- pattern GL_WEIGHT_SUM_UNITY_ARB :: GLenum
- glVertexBlendARB :: MonadIO m => GLint -> m ()
- glWeightPointerARB :: MonadIO m => GLint -> GLenum -> GLsizei -> Ptr a -> m ()
- glWeightbvARB :: MonadIO m => GLint -> Ptr GLbyte -> m ()
- glWeightdvARB :: MonadIO m => GLint -> Ptr GLdouble -> m ()
- glWeightfvARB :: MonadIO m => GLint -> Ptr GLfloat -> m ()
- glWeightivARB :: MonadIO m => GLint -> Ptr GLint -> m ()
- glWeightsvARB :: MonadIO m => GLint -> Ptr GLshort -> m ()
- glWeightubvARB :: MonadIO m => GLint -> Ptr GLubyte -> m ()
- glWeightuivARB :: MonadIO m => GLint -> Ptr GLuint -> m ()
- glWeightusvARB :: MonadIO m => GLint -> Ptr GLushort -> m ()
Extension Support
glGetARBVertexBlend :: MonadIO m => m Bool Source #
Is the ARB_vertex_blend extension supported?
gl_ARB_vertex_blend :: Bool Source #
Is the ARB_vertex_blend extension supported?
Note that in the presence of multiple contexts with different capabilities,
this might be wrong. Use glGetARBVertexBlend
in those cases instead.
Enums
pattern GL_ACTIVE_VERTEX_UNITS_ARB :: GLenum Source #
pattern GL_CURRENT_WEIGHT_ARB :: GLenum Source #
pattern GL_MAX_VERTEX_UNITS_ARB :: GLenum Source #
pattern GL_MODELVIEW0_ARB :: GLenum Source #
pattern GL_MODELVIEW10_ARB :: GLenum Source #
pattern GL_MODELVIEW11_ARB :: GLenum Source #
pattern GL_MODELVIEW12_ARB :: GLenum Source #
pattern GL_MODELVIEW13_ARB :: GLenum Source #
pattern GL_MODELVIEW14_ARB :: GLenum Source #
pattern GL_MODELVIEW15_ARB :: GLenum Source #
pattern GL_MODELVIEW16_ARB :: GLenum Source #
pattern GL_MODELVIEW17_ARB :: GLenum Source #
pattern GL_MODELVIEW18_ARB :: GLenum Source #
pattern GL_MODELVIEW19_ARB :: GLenum Source #
pattern GL_MODELVIEW1_ARB :: GLenum Source #
pattern GL_MODELVIEW20_ARB :: GLenum Source #
pattern GL_MODELVIEW21_ARB :: GLenum Source #
pattern GL_MODELVIEW22_ARB :: GLenum Source #
pattern GL_MODELVIEW23_ARB :: GLenum Source #
pattern GL_MODELVIEW24_ARB :: GLenum Source #
pattern GL_MODELVIEW25_ARB :: GLenum Source #
pattern GL_MODELVIEW26_ARB :: GLenum Source #
pattern GL_MODELVIEW27_ARB :: GLenum Source #
pattern GL_MODELVIEW28_ARB :: GLenum Source #
pattern GL_MODELVIEW29_ARB :: GLenum Source #
pattern GL_MODELVIEW2_ARB :: GLenum Source #
pattern GL_MODELVIEW30_ARB :: GLenum Source #
pattern GL_MODELVIEW31_ARB :: GLenum Source #
pattern GL_MODELVIEW3_ARB :: GLenum Source #
pattern GL_MODELVIEW4_ARB :: GLenum Source #
pattern GL_MODELVIEW5_ARB :: GLenum Source #
pattern GL_MODELVIEW6_ARB :: GLenum Source #
pattern GL_MODELVIEW7_ARB :: GLenum Source #
pattern GL_MODELVIEW8_ARB :: GLenum Source #
pattern GL_MODELVIEW9_ARB :: GLenum Source #
pattern GL_VERTEX_BLEND_ARB :: GLenum Source #
pattern GL_WEIGHT_ARRAY_ARB :: GLenum Source #
pattern GL_WEIGHT_ARRAY_POINTER_ARB :: GLenum Source #
pattern GL_WEIGHT_ARRAY_SIZE_ARB :: GLenum Source #
pattern GL_WEIGHT_ARRAY_STRIDE_ARB :: GLenum Source #
pattern GL_WEIGHT_ARRAY_TYPE_ARB :: GLenum Source #
pattern GL_WEIGHT_SUM_UNITY_ARB :: GLenum Source #